Output dd1d36fe32f4cb01510239aed90ae1bbe3315e788f62cf00d240a1d0abebe48d:3

value
836594
script pubkey
OP_0 OP_PUSHBYTES_20 dacf3650e2c9695b51ebe136be634cedca2c19f4
address
bc1qmt8nv58ze954k50tuymtuc6vah9zcx05akjn9y
transaction
dd1d36fe32f4cb01510239aed90ae1bbe3315e788f62cf00d240a1d0abebe48d
spent
true